The upregulated expression of warmth shock proteins (HSPs) impairs the therapeutic efficacy of photothermal remedy (PTT). Inhibition of HSPs restore is an extraordinarily powerful for bettering the efficiency of low-temperature PTT.
A brand unique see by the Chinese language Academy of Sciences has advised a novel formula to inhibit the expression of HSPs. The scheme involves utilizing carbon oxide gasoline. It offers an alternative scheme for enhancing low-temperature PTT.
Scientists began by increasing a chemiexcitation-introduced about photo-active nano transport system known as AIE nanobomb. This methodology is consistent with the self-assembly of NIR-II luminescent polymer with aggregation-triggered emission properties (PBPTV) and home made carbon monoxide (CO) carrier polymer MPEG(CO). The excessive focus of H2O2 within the tumor microenvironment would possibly perchance maybe plan off the nano bomb, which can maybe perchance then selectively liberate CO gasoline within the tumor cells.
Oversecreted H2O2 diffuses all around the nano bomb within the cancerous microenvironment to preferentially decompose into OH radicals by task of a Fenton-adore reaction, and strongly oxidative OH radicals additional oxidize and competitively coordinate with the Fe middle, ensuing within the liberate of CO from the Fe middle. At some stage within the low-temperature PTT direction of, the progressively released CO would possibly perchance maybe effectively suppress the increased manufacturing of HSPs to diminish tumor thermal resistance and promote tumor apoptosis.

Dr. GONG Ping Gong, another main contributor to this see, said, “As a signaling molecule, carbon oxide (CO) can plan off a sequence of cell protective mechanisms in stress and irritation. The mechanism of CO down-regulating HSPs protein is aloof unclear. In accordance with some literature, we would possibly perchance maybe simply hypothesize that it would possibly perchance perchance maybe simply be related to the LKB1/AMPK/mTOR pathway, however lots of work is aloof wanted to existing it.”
The use of the bis-pyridal-thiadiazole unit in PBPTV, an ambipolar pyridal thiadiazole-essentially essentially based semiconducting polymer enables for excessive electron affinity, a low LUMO level, and prolonged -conjugation. This has shown colossal promise for increasing excessive-performance electron-transporting semiconductors in natural electronics.
